"I've been to Richie's around 15 times, usually to order takeout."
Phone: +18479288500,+18479288509
Address: 9812 Lawrence Ave. Schiller Park, IL 60176, United States
Reservation, Booking
City: Schiller Park
Website: http://richiesmenu.com
Monday: 06:00-00:30
Tuesday: 06:00-00:30
Wednesday: 06:00-00:30
Thursday: 06:00-00:30
Friday: 06:00-00:30
Saturday: 06:00-01:00
Sunday: 06:00-00:00
Dishes: 10
Categories: 5
Reviews: 4448